2.1 reads multiple requests into a string like R1/R2/R3...
2.2 looping to break the requests String and do
2.21 parsing request
2.22 framing response
2.23 send header
2.24 send files (only if 200 allowed )
3.1 sending single request
illegal path? relative path?
file permission check
different file types: jpg png html txt
3,2 multiple requests in one client message
EX cat <(printf "GET /testing.txt HTTP/1.1\r\nHost: localhost\r\n\r\n") <(printf "GET /testing2.txt HTTP/1.1\r\nHost: localhost\r\n\r\n") <(printf "GET /testing3.txt HTTP/1.1\r\nHost: localhost\r\n\r\n") <(printf "GET /testing4.txt HTTP/1.1\r\nHost: localhost\r\nConnection: close\r\n\r\n") | nc localhost 9000
3.3 multi threading to handle multi users requesting and the same time
3.4 handle timeout.
set time out to be 5 seconds for each user, if no request recieved in 5 sec, cut connection.
